I recently had a conversation with my nephew who is a county police officer. He hopes to make the S.W.A.T. team. As a reward for his accomplishment he plans to buy a knife. He described to me what he was looking for. I have his approval that our new knife will foot the bill.

Pictured below, is the Tom Brown Tracker. It has a 6 1/4" blade made of 1095 high carbon alloy. There is a 2 1/2" saw back with black traction coating. The knife has a 5 1/2" gray linen micarta handle.
